The International Union for Pure and Applied Biophysics (IUPAB) was established in 1961 in Stockholm, as the International Organization for Pure and Applied Biophysics. The objectives are: to organize international cooperation in biophysics and promote communication between the societies that are interested in the advancement of biophysics in all aspects. In order to achieve these objectives it has power to: set up commissions or bodies for special purposes; organize international meetings and conferences; collaborate with other scientific organizations; act in all ways as a constituent Union of the International Council for Science in accordance with the Statutes of that body; develop any activity deemed helpful to the advancement of its declared objectives.
